Dans les réseaux informatiques, un paquet Keepalive est un paquet spécial envoyé entre les appareils d'un réseau à intervalles réguliers afin de maintenir la connexion réseau ouverte. Il répond à plusieurs objectifs importants :
1. Test de connectivité :Les paquets Keepalive aident à maintenir un lien de communication continu entre les appareils, leur permettant de vérifier s'il existe une connexion active. En envoyant périodiquement ces paquets, les appareils peuvent confirmer que l'autre appareil est toujours présent sur le réseau.
2. Sonde les appareils inactifs :Si un appareil n'a pas communiqué depuis un certain temps, un paquet keepalive peut être envoyé pour sonder son état. Cela permet de détecter les pannes de périphériques ou les problèmes de connectivité temporaires, permettant ainsi d'effectuer des actions appropriées telles que la reconnexion ou le redémarrage des périphériques si nécessaire.
3. Prévenir l'expiration de la session :De nombreuses applications et services réseau ont des délais d'expiration de session inactive. Cela signifie que s'il n'y a aucune activité pendant une période prédéterminée, la session se terminera automatiquement. Les paquets Keepalive évitent les expirations de session en actualisant périodiquement la communication, prolongeant ainsi efficacement la durée de vie de la session et empêchant les interruptions inattendues.
4. Optimiser l'utilisation des ressources :Les paquets Keepalive peuvent être particulièrement utiles pour conserver les ressources dans des environnements où les appareils fonctionnent dans des scénarios de connexion à faible consommation ou intermittents. En maintenant une connexion ouverte, les appareils évitent d'avoir à établir de nouvelles connexions à plusieurs reprises, ce qui peut nécessiter plus de ressources et ajouter une surcharge au réseau.
5. Détection des problèmes de réseau :Les paquets Keepalive peuvent aider à identifier dès le début les problèmes de réseau sous-jacents. Si un paquet keepalive n'est pas reconnu ou ne parvient pas à atteindre sa destination, cela peut indiquer des problèmes de connectivité ou des pannes de périphérique, déclenchant d'autres activités de dépannage et de maintenance.
En résumé, les paquets keepalive sont essentiels pour garantir une communication fiable et maintenir une connectivité continue entre les appareils d'un réseau. Ils évitent les délais d'expiration des sessions inactives, testent la connectivité réseau, sondent l'état des appareils, aident à détecter les problèmes de réseau et optimisent l'utilisation des ressources, améliorant ainsi les performances globales et la fiabilité de l'infrastructure réseau.
|